Takashimaya Company, Limited

Takashimaya Company, Limited, a prominent player in the retail industry, is headquartered in Japan and operates extensively across Asia. Founded in 1831, the company has evolved into a leading department store chain, renowned for its exceptional customer service and high-quality merchandise. With a diverse portfolio that includes fashion, cosmetics, home goods, and gourmet food, Takashimaya distinguishes itself through a commitment to luxury and innovation. The company has achieved significant milestones, including the expansion of its flagship stores in major cities like Tokyo and Osaka, solidifying its market position as a trusted brand in the retail sector. Takashimaya's unique blend of traditional Japanese hospitality and modern retail practices continues to attract a loyal customer base, making it a key player in the competitive landscape of department stores in Asia.

Takashimaya Company, Limited's reported carbon emissions

In 2020, Takashimaya Company, Limited reported total carbon emissions of approximately 2,495,547,000 kg CO2e, with significant contributions from Scope 3 emissions, which accounted for about 2,495,547,000 kg CO2e. Scope 1 emissions were approximately 21,055,000 kg CO2e, while Scope 2 emissions totalled around 178,090,000 kg CO2e. Comparatively, in 2019, the company emitted about 3,382,417,000 kg CO2e, with Scope 3 emissions again being the largest contributor at approximately 3,382,417,000 kg CO2e. Scope 1 emissions for that year were around 24,953,000 kg CO2e, and Scope 2 emissions were about 205,563,000 kg CO2e.
